优化工具链,加速建站与后端开发
|
在现代Web开发中,建站与后端开发的效率直接影响项目交付周期。传统的手动配置环境、逐项安装依赖、反复调试部署流程,不仅耗时,还容易引入人为错误。通过优化工具链,可以大幅减少重复劳动,让开发者更专注于核心逻辑实现。 构建现代化的开发环境,关键在于使用成熟的自动化工具。例如,借助Node.js生态中的包管理器npm或yarn,可以一键安装项目所需的所有依赖,并通过package.json统一管理版本和脚本命令。配合Webpack、Vite等构建工具,前端资源的打包、压缩、热更新都能自动完成,极大提升开发体验。
本图由AI生成,仅供参考 对于后端开发,采用如Express、Koa或NestJS等框架,配合TypeScript可增强代码的可维护性与类型安全性。通过Docker容器化部署,能确保开发、测试、生产环境的一致性,避免“在我机器上能跑”的尴尬问题。结合CI/CD工具(如GitHub Actions、GitLab CI),代码提交后可自动运行测试、构建镜像并部署到服务器,实现持续集成与交付。 数据库方面,使用ORM(如Prisma、TypeORM)能简化数据操作,通过代码定义模型结构,避免直接编写原始SQL。配合迁移工具,数据库结构变更可版本化管理,降低出错风险。同时,API文档自动生成工具(如Swagger)可实时生成接口说明,提升前后端协作效率。 开发过程中引入代码规范检查工具(如ESLint、Prettier)和单元测试框架(如Jest),有助于早期发现潜在问题,保障代码质量。团队共享配置文件与脚手架模板,还能统一项目结构,降低新人上手成本。 优化工具链并非一蹴而就,而是持续迭代的过程。定期评估现有工具的适用性,根据项目规模和团队需求调整方案,才能真正实现高效开发。当工具链稳定运行,开发者便能将精力集中在业务逻辑与用户体验上,推动项目快速迭代与落地。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

